R语言升级指南:从基础到高级
R语言是一种广泛使用的统计分析和图形展示的编程语言,它具有强大的数据处理能力。随着R语言的不断发展,定期升级R语言可以确保我们使用最新的功能和改进。本文将介绍如何升级R语言,并提供一个实际问题的解决示例。
为什么需要升级R语言?
升级R语言有以下几个原因:
- 安全性:新版本通常修复了旧版本中的安全漏洞。
- 性能提升:新版本可能包含性能优化,提高运行速度。
- 新功能:新版本引入了新的功能和改进,扩展了语言的能力。
- 兼容性:确保与新的R包和工具的兼容性。
如何升级R语言?
升级R语言通常涉及以下几个步骤:
-
检查当前版本:首先,我们需要知道当前安装的R语言版本。
version
-
下载新版本:访问[CRAN](
-
安装新版本:根据你的操作系统,安装下载的R语言版本。
-
配置环境变量(如果需要):确保R语言的可执行文件路径添加到系统的环境变量中。
-
验证安装:安装完成后,打开R语言控制台并输入
version
命令来验证新版本是否安装成功。
示例:解决实际问题
假设我们需要解决一个数据清洗的问题,我们的数据集中包含了一些缺失值和异常值,我们需要升级R语言以使用最新的数据清洗功能。
步骤1:检查当前R语言版本
version
步骤2:下载并安装新版本的R
访问CRAN网站,下载适合你操作系统的最新版本R,并按照指示进行安装。
步骤3:使用新功能进行数据清洗
假设新版本的R引入了一个名为clean_data
的新函数,我们可以使用这个函数来清洗数据。
# 假设的clean_data函数
clean_data <- function(data) {
# 清洗数据的代码
# ...
return(cleaned_data)
}
# 应用clean_data函数
cleaned_data <- clean_data(your_data)
状态图:R语言升级流程
以下是使用Mermaid语法创建的R语言升级流程的状态图:
stateDiagram-v2
[*] --> CheckCurrentVersion: 检查当前版本
CheckCurrentVersion --> DownloadNewVersion: 下载新版本
DownloadNewVersion --> InstallNewVersion: 安装新版本
InstallNewVersion --> ConfigureEnvironment: 配置环境变量(如果需要)
ConfigureEnvironment --> VerifyInstallation: 验证安装
VerifyInstallation --> [*]
结论
升级R语言是一个简单但重要的过程,它可以帮助我们利用最新的功能和改进。通过遵循上述步骤,我们可以确保我们的R环境始终保持最新状态。记住,定期检查R语言的更新,并根据需要进行升级,是保持数据分析工作顺利进行的关键。